Overview of the ARCTIC Liquid Freezer III Pro 360
The ARCTIC Liquid Freezer III Pro 360 is a high-performance AIO CPU cooler priced at £67.49. It is designed for optimal CPU cooling through advanced features that enhance both performance and longevity. The cooler includes a contact frame tailored for Intel LGA1851 and LGA1700 sockets, ensuring effective heat dissipation and better pressure distribution, which is essential for maintaining CPU health over time.
This cooler stands out due to its powerful P12 PRO fan, which operates more efficiently and quietly than its predecessor. Users can expect superior cooling performance, especially under heavy loads, thanks to the fan’s higher maximum speed. Additionally, the integrated VRM fan aids in reducing the temperature of voltage converters, ensuring that the CPU operates reliably even in demanding situations.
Overview of the CORSAIR COMMANDER DUO
The CORSAIR COMMANDER DUO is an RGB lighting and PWM ARGB fan controller priced at £29.95. This device offers a dual functionality by supporting both ARGB PWM fans and iCUE LINK devices, making it an excellent choice for users looking to create a cohesive fan and lighting ecosystem. Its streamlined interface allows for seamless integration and control of various connected devices.
With two channels available, the Commander Duo can control up to six daisy-chained fans per channel, allowing for a total of twelve fans. This is particularly advantageous for larger builds where airflow management is crucial. The intelligent fan control feature provided by CORSAIR's iCUE software enables precise adjustments, enhancing the overall performance and aesthetics of the system.

Design and Aesthetics
The aesthetic appeal of PC components is a significant consideration for many enthusiasts. The ARCTIC Liquid Freezer III Pro 360 features a sleek and modern design that complements high-end builds, with a focus on both performance and visual appeal. Its integrated cable management system ensures a clean look by minimizing visible cables, which is often a concern in custom builds.
On the other hand, the CORSAIR COMMANDER DUO shines in terms of lighting control. It allows users to synchronise RGB lighting across multiple fans, providing a cohesive and vibrant visual experience. The ability to manage up to 50 LEDs per ARGB channel enables extensive customisation, which is a significant advantage for users looking to enhance their system’s aesthetics.
